It's comparable to Placing the blocks through a superior-velocity blender, with Every single round further puréeing the combination into a thing totally new.
Before we could possibly get to the specifics of MD5, it’s important to Have got a reliable understanding of what a hash purpose is.
When the hash value of the file matches a acknowledged destructive hash benefit, the antivirus flags the file as malware. This technique allows antivirus packages to speedily establish and block malware without having to scan the entire file.
MD5 should not be employed for safety applications or when collision resistance is vital. With confirmed stability vulnerabilities and the benefit at which collisions is usually designed using MD5, other safer hash values are suggested.
This is where an attacker tries every single doable password mix until they locate the best just one. The a lot quicker the algorithm, the quicker these attacks can take place.
Authentic solutions for the Firm and conclusion buyers constructed with best of breed offerings, configured to get adaptable and scalable along with you.
MD5 is usually Employed in digital signatures. Much like how a physical signature verifies the authenticity of a document, a digital signature verifies the authenticity of digital information.
So how does an MD5 operate do the job? Fundamentally, you feed this Resource data—no matter if a doc, a video, a bit of code, just about anything—and in return, MD5 will crank out a singular and glued-sized hash code. If even a single character is altered in that unique established of knowledge, it would produce a totally unique hash.
Inside the context of MD5, a 'salt' is yet another random benefit that you include to the facts right before hashing. This makes it Significantly more difficult for an attacker to guess your knowledge based upon the hash.
Digital Forensics: MD5 is check here used in the sector of digital forensics to verify the integrity of electronic evidence, like hard drives, CDs, or DVDs. The investigators build an MD5 hash of the initial information and Look at it Along with the MD5 hash in the copied digital proof.
MD5 is really a cryptographic hash function, which implies that it's a certain sort of hash perform that has a lot of the similar characteristics since the 1 explained earlier mentioned.
The MD5 (message-digest algorithm five) hashing algorithm is often a cryptographic protocol accustomed to authenticate messages and digital signatures. The most crucial function of MD5 is always to verify which the receiver of a message or file is finding the exact same information which was sent.
Flame utilized MD5 hash collisions to generate copyright Microsoft update certificates used to authenticate significant units. The good thing is, the vulnerability was found out promptly, and also a software package update was issued to close this safety hole. This associated switching to working with SHA-one for Microsoft certificates.
Irrespective of its Preliminary intention, MD5 is thought of as broken due to its vulnerability to varied attack vectors. Collisions, the place two various inputs develop the identical hash benefit, could be created with relative ease applying modern day computational ability. As a result, MD5 is now not suggested for cryptographic uses, like password storage.